Chris Jernigan and I drove to Charlotte on Sunday. I enjoyed it but it was much smaller than in pat years. The talk among the vendors is that there is a new Co coming to do a Dealer show in Tampa, Fla next year. Also looking to do a IMS type show... To put this company out of business. This could be very good since the show has sucked more each year. Yamaha, Kawasaki and Gerbing pulled out at the last show before Charlotte this year!!

Chris and I both bought BMG = British Motorcycle Gear Explorer jackets. End of show/season discounts
I was looking to see the new Shoie GT AIR helmet. Duhhhh not at the show. I want one but $497 is a lot!!!
